Lincoln Mercury Invitational Final Results
BEDMINSTER, N.J. - Junior Brian Colbert (Cary, Ill.) finished the fall season with a strong performance at the Lincoln Mercury Invitational at the River Course of Fiddler's Elbow Country Club in Bedminster, N.J. The junior shot a final round 72 to finish with a 145 (+1) just four shots back in the thirty-six hole event. As a team, Villanova finished alone in third place with a 599 (+23).
Rounding out the top five for Villanova were senior Brendan Kelly (Annapolis, Md.) (75-73--148; +4), senior Conor Casey (Madison, N.J.) (73-760--149; +5), sophomore Steve Skurla (Wheaton, Ill.) (79-78--157; +13), and sophomore Michael Kania (Haverford, Pa.) (82-78--160; +16) who finished tied for 11th, 13th, 50th, and 64th respectively.
Also competing for Villanova was senior Colin List (Boynton Beach, Fla.) (81-81--162; +18) who finished tied for 74th.
In the team competition Villanova finished behind champion Binghamton (587) and second place Temple (592). Individually, Delaware's Justin Marthson took home the title with a 141 (-3).
Villanova's fall season is now over and they won't be back in action until the spring season.
